Description

RN - Extended Care

Location: Miles City, Montana
Employment Type: Staffing - Supplier Sourced
Contract Length: 13 weeks


Job Summary

  • Provide holistic nursing care focusing on the individual’s role within their family, culture, and society.
  • Utilize the nursing process: assessment, diagnosis, planning, implementation, and evaluation.
  • Advocate for residents by ensuring they and/or their representatives have adequate information for health decisions.
  • Coordinate total care to help residents achieve or maintain their highest practicable level of function.
  • Maintain quality of resident care according to legal and professional standards.
  • Serve as a role model to other healthcare team members.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ities

  • Complete age-specific admission history, physical assessments, and nursing care plans for assigned residents.
  • Analyze clinical data (labs, x-rays, diagnostics) to develop individualized care plans.
  • Identify and document residents at risk for nutritional and functional decline.
  • Recognize and report signs of neglect or abuse (child, domestic, elder).
  • Set priorities and review daily care plans in collaboration with residents, families, and healthcare team.
  • Delegate tasks to team members based on resident needs and staff competencies.
  • Communicate with physicians to coordinate medical and nursing care plans.
  • Perform technical nursing skills competently.
  • Manage urgent and emergent resident care situations proactively.
  • Administer medications and IVs per scope of practice and policy.
  • Document nursing interventions, resident responses, and outcomes.
  • Evaluate and revise care plans based on resident progress and changing needs.
  • Provide education to residents and families based on assessed learning needs.
  • Coordinate discharge planning and related documentation.
  • Maintain knowledge of CMS regulations, Medicare skilled care, and MDS criteria to ensure compliant documentation.
  • Incorporate resident preferences into care delivery and delegate tasks appropriately.
  • Supervise, coach, counsel, and evaluate assigned CNA staff.

Required Qualifications

  • Registered Nurse (RN) license appropriate for Montana.
  • Ability to read and write at a level sufficient for documentation requirements.
  • Physical ability to perform job duties including standing, walking, sitting, pushing, pulling, lifting, carrying, stooping, kneeling, crouching, reaching, filing, typing, talking, hearing, and color vision.
  • Capable of lifting objects over 100 lbs., with frequent lifting/carrying up to 50 lbs.
